GTA Autoslalom - 2014 PITL Event #6, Sun August 10 (Brampton, ON)
 
2014 PITL - Event #6, Sun August 10
http://www.wiredmotorsports.com/pitl
@PITL_Ca


Event 6 Announcements:
  • Please bring your drivers' license to check-in. Copy of MSR receipt is no longer required.
  • Online registration closes at 6:00 AM August 10th. NO EXCUSES!
  • On-site registration closes at 8:45 AM sharp for all competitors.


Event Registration link: http://msreg.com/pitl6

Venue:
Bramalea Go-Train Station - South lot

Directions:
Dixie Road, north of Hwy 407 to Advance Blvd, east to Alfred Kuehne Blvd follow to end.
http://maps.google.ca/maps?f=q&sourc...1,0.01929&z=16


Event Schedule:
Registration 7:30-8:45
Drivers' meeting 9:00
First car 9:15


Entry fee:
$40.00 / driver LUNCH INCLUDED! (Hamburger or Veggieburger, Coke/Diet Coke/Ice Tea/Water)
$7 / extra lunch


Questions?
Email thelimit@rogers.com


Other 2014 Event Dates:
Saturday August 23
Sunday September 7
